Driver Enlightens Two HB-LED Strings

Feb. 10, 2010
the MAX16838 emerges as the industry's only two-string high-brightness LED driver for automotive apps
Integrating a boost switching converter, two linear current sinks, and all necessary power MOSFETs, the MAX16838 emerges as the industry's only two-string high-brightness LED driver for automotive apps. It is able to optimize conversion efficiency, provide complete fault protection, and allow a 5000:1 dimming range-without any external components. Other features include LED fault, over-temperature, and over-voltage protections. Delivering up to 150 mA per string, the MAX16838 operates over a temperature range from -40°C to +125°C and accepts a 4.75V to 40V input range. Available in 20-pin, 4 mm x 4 mm TSSOP and TQFN packages, prices start at $1.45 each/1,000. MAXIM INTEGRATED PRODUCTS, Sunnyvale, CA. (800) 998-8800.
